Samuel Johnson Quotes
Showing: 181 - 190 Samuel Johnson Quotes of 325
Every man prefers virtue, when there is not some strong incitement to transgress its precepts.
It is better to live rich than to die rich.
Wickedness is always easier than virtue, for it takes the short cut to everything.
When female minds are embittered by age or solitude, their malignity is generally exerted in a rigorous and spiteful superintendence of domestic trifles.
A man may write at any time, if he will set himself doggedly to it.
No man but a blockhead ever wrote except for money
What is written without effort is in general read without pleasure.
Most vices may be committed very genteelly: a man may debauch his friend's wife genteelly: he may cheat at cards genteelly
Age looks with anger on the temerity of youth, and youth with contempt on the scrupulosity of age.
He that would pass the latter part of life with honour and decency must, when he is young, consider that he shall one day be old; and remember, when he is old, that he has once been young.
